Ash Exantus better known to the world as Ash Cash is one of the nation's top financial educators. Dubbed as the Financial Motivator, he uses a culturally responsive approach in teaching wealth, entrepreneurship, self-sufficiency, and financial empowerment.


From the Block to the Bank is a story of how a young man born into a low-income family used his circumstance to change the trajectory of his family and community.


Ash was born and raised in a single-parent home in Harlem NYC. He became an entrepreneur at the early age of eight, packing grocery bags at the local supermarket, then graduating by age twelve to selling mixtapes and t-shirts on the famous 125th street as a street vendor.


Ash started his banking career as a teller at the age of nineteen and worked his way up to several promotions. At the tender age of twenty-four, he became a VP at one of the largest banks in the country. At age thirty-one, Ash became one of the youngest CEO's of a federally chartered bank.


Now as a full-time entrepreneur and wealth coach he has touched millions of lives directly and indirectly and is sharing his story on how to make an impact while making an income.
